Early Voting Has Started for Prince George’s County Executive and District 5 Council Seat
Early voting for the Prince George’s County Executive and District 5 Council seat. Polls will be open from 10:00am to 8:00pm Wednesday through Saturday, 12:00pm to 6:00pm Sunday and 10:00am to 8:00pm Monday.
On Election Day, polls will be open from 7:00am to 8:00pm.
Ballot drop boxes will be open until 8:00pm on Tuesday.
Bowie Plans Revitalization of Serene Way Park, Invites Community Input
The City of Bowie is transforming Serene Way Park into a vibrant micro-park, enhancing the space between Spark Lane and the Bowie High School Annex. This initiative aims to create a welcoming, community-friendly environment by adding new amenities and green space.
To ensure the project meets residents' needs, city officials are inviting the community to a public meeting at the Kenhill Center on March 5 at 6:00pm. Attendees will have the opportunity to review proposed ideas and share feedback on the park’s future design.
The revitalization effort reflects Bowie’s commitment to improving public spaces and fostering community engagement. Residents are encouraged to participate in shaping this exciting transformation.
